    From Butcher's Shop to World-Class Distillery

    Stauning was founded in 2005 by nine friends, all of whom had different professions – doctor, engineer, butcher. Their common denominator: a passion for whisky and the desire to make it themselves. They started with the simplest means in an old butcher's shop in the small town of Stauning on the west coast of Jutland.

    The first official Stauning Whisky was released in 2009. The reactions surprised even the founders: critics and connoisseurs were enthusiastic. In 2019, Diageo acquired a minority stake – a clear signal that the industry's giants were taking Stauning seriously. Nevertheless, the distillery remained true to its signature style.

    The Stauning Philosophy: Everything Under One Roof

    What distinguishes Stauning from most other distilleries is its consistent "farm-to-bottle" approach. Stauning malts its grain itself – on the floor, using traditional methods. This is elaborate, expensive, and time-consuming. But it gives the distillery a control over the taste that hardly any other distillery worldwide has.

    Distillation takes place in small pot stills – 24 of them are located in the new distillery, which opened in 2019. This multitude of small stills allows for enormous flexibility and complexity in the distillate.     Local Raw Materials, Danish Character

    Stauning consistently relies on Danish grain. Rye, barley, and wheat come from local farmers in the region. The heather used for the smoked bottlings grows in the immediate vicinity of the distillery. The result is a whisky that unmistakably tastes of its origin – of Jutland, of the North Sea, of Scandinavia.

    This connection between terroir and taste is not a marketing promise, but a handcrafted reality. Stauning shows that whisky can be an expression of its place – similar to a good wine.

    The Styles: Rye, Malt, Smoke and More

    Stauning produces several clearly defined styles, each highlighting a different aspect of the Danish terroir:

    • Rye: The distillery's signature style. Made from 100% Danish rye, matured in a combination of new and used oak casks. Robust, spicy, with a dry elegance.
    • Malt / Barley: Classic single malt style, but with a Danish touch. Fruity, approachable, complex.
    • Smoke: Smoked over Danish heather instead of peat – this results in a softer, herbaceous smoke that clearly differs from Islay whiskies.
    • Kaos: A blend of all Stauning styles – the name says it all. Playful, surprising, always different.

    Awards and International Recognition

    Stauning has accumulated an impressive list of awards in a short time. Medals at the World Whiskies Award, top ratings in Jim Murray's Whisky Bible, regular mentions in major trade magazines – the distillery is no longer an insider tip.
